I think it's very possible to have a good player emerge from a youth with a PA under 170. It all depends on the point distribution.
The fact that are is really only 1 player in your game (and I stress, only in your game) with a relatively high PA doesn't mean its flawed or anything. As mentioned, FRED generation is a very random process, and it's very much down to luck.
